    Car Ignition Switch Replacement

    It is crucial that the ignition switch works correctly as it permits you to start your car. Luckily, ignition switch replacement is relatively easy.

    A malfunctioning switch can cause other components of your vehicle to stop functioning or even stop working while you're driving. This is why you should get a locksmith in touch immediately when you notice any issues with the switch.

    Take off the Ignition Switch

    The ignition switch is an essential element of your car's electrical systems. The ignition switch is responsible for the start of the engine in your car as well as powering accessories such as the radio, lights, and door locks. If the switch fails your car might not start or even stall out while driving.

    If you think that your ignition switch isn't functioning, you should call a mechanic for an accurate diagnosis. In addition, you should look at relays and fuses because they are frequently damaged due to corrosion or water. Once you have ruled out these other problems and you are ready to replace the ignition switch.

    The process for replacing your ignition switch could differ according to the model and model of your vehicle. For instance, certain modern vehicles are fitted with antitheft mechanisms that require special tools to remove. In some instances the devices may require a reset to work with an entirely new switch.     Removing the Electrical Part

    The ignition switch is the main line of power for your vehicle, providing energy to all the essential systems and accessories in your vehicle. If this component fails, your engine won't start, and your car will not be in a position to perform any of its normal functions. The ignition switch is responsible for transmitting the signal required to activate other car parts, such as radios and power windows.

    The ignition switch is a crucial part of your vehicle and is prone to fail due to wear and tear or other issues. There are many ways to keep it in good condition and avoid the need for a replacement. One of the most effective ways to accomplish this is to decrease the number of keycycles that are unnecessary which could be a result of things like an excessive keychain or a broken one.

    Removing the Switch from the Dashboard

    You know how frustrating it is to be stuck due to the fact that your ignition switch was not working. In certain instances this issue could be dangerous if your vehicle stops in traffic. There are ways to fix the ignition switch and prevent any future issues.

    The ignition switch is a complicated element of a vehicle that requires replacement regularly to ensure maximum performance. They are typically the first to experience problems due to corrosion and wear however, other factors may also contribute to their failure. For instance, heavy keychains, can cause the ignition to be stretched when it is inserted. This accelerates wear and tear on the internal components. Furthermore, the climate of a vehicle can influence the lubricants and materials within the ignition key replacement switch.
